| Index: src/x64/codegen-x64.cc
|
| ===================================================================
|
| --- src/x64/codegen-x64.cc (revision 15265)
|
| +++ src/x64/codegen-x64.cc (working copy)
|
| @@ -346,7 +346,7 @@
|
|
|
| // Allocate new backing store.
|
| __ bind(&new_backing_store);
|
| - __ lea(rdi, Operand(r9, times_pointer_size, FixedArray::kHeaderSize));
|
| + __ lea(rdi, Operand(r9, times_8, FixedArray::kHeaderSize));
|
| __ Allocate(rdi, r14, r11, r15, fail, TAG_OBJECT);
|
| // Set backing store's map
|
| __ LoadRoot(rdi, Heap::kFixedDoubleArrayMapRootIndex);
|
| @@ -381,7 +381,7 @@
|
| // Conversion loop.
|
| __ bind(&loop);
|
| __ movq(rbx,
|
| - FieldOperand(r8, r9, times_8, FixedArray::kHeaderSize));
|
| + FieldOperand(r8, r9, times_pointer_size, FixedArray::kHeaderSize));
|
| // r9 : current element's index
|
| // rbx: current element (smi-tagged)
|
| __ JumpIfNotSmi(rbx, &convert_hole);
|
| @@ -459,7 +459,7 @@
|
| __ bind(&loop);
|
| __ movq(r14, FieldOperand(r8,
|
| r9,
|
| - times_pointer_size,
|
| + times_8,
|
| FixedDoubleArray::kHeaderSize));
|
| // r9 : current element's index
|
| // r14: current element
|
|
|